In 1709, Anne Thacker Reed entered the world in Pittsville, Pittsylvania, Virginia, USA, born to Sir William Baronet Skipwith And Us Lady Sarah Peyton. Anne Thacker Reed married John Comer Peck Peek, and had children including George Peek. Anne Thacker Reed passed away in 1775 in Prince Edward, Virginia, USA.
